Forgot to put bumpstop back on during CC plate inst.
I realized they were still on my cart after the whole thing was put together Do I need to the bumpstops on or can I do without them? What do they do, anyway?

If your strut can compress and bottom out, you will blow out your strut. OR, you will compress your springs till coil bind (metal on metal), also bad.
Take it apart, and put a bumpstop on there. You'll want to bottom out on something made of rubber, not a strut rod or coils.
